Transaction 8e84faacf47567996170abe594a6c1bc3c9bb6895ae17b2cc6fef539a72b2b04
1 Input
1 Output
-
8e84faacf47567996170abe594a6c1bc3c9bb6895ae17b2cc6fef539a72b2b04:0
- value
- 27153
- script pubkey
- OP_0 OP_PUSHBYTES_20 c266f058b14e1a5b6fc44d4f6dbb42e13f8acd58
- address
- bc1qcfn0qk93fcd9km7yf48kmw6zuylc4n2cj4vcgu